I found a map breaking bug in the Adventure branch.
The greenhouse puzzle did not work at first on my playthrough, neither entering and exiting the branch or reinstalling the map fixed it. None of the buttons activated anything. After some examination of the redstone, I found that the comparator placed by the proximity detector was not detecting the item moving in the hopper clock so none of the needed commands were activating.
As I reinstalled the map, this seems to be a problem specific to me. However I had all the recommendations except the 4g of ram, I had only 2g, and I used a render distance of 12. It seems to be some kind of chunkloading or block update issue.
It does not seem to be happening to many if any players, but I'm just notifying you that this happened.
